The Aomori Autumn

Aomori, located in the northernmost part of Japan’s Honshu island, is a stunning destination during the autumn season. From late September to November, the region transforms into a vibrant canvas of red, orange, and yellow as the leaves change. Explore the majestic beauty of places like Lake Towada, Oirase Gorge, and Hakkoda Mountains, where scenic trails and hot springs offer the perfect backdrop to witness the fall foliage.

Aomori is also famous for its traditional festivals, like the Aomori Nebuta Matsuri, which continue to captivate visitors. Whether you’re hiking, relaxing in nature, or enjoying local delicacies like apples and seafood, Aomori in autumn offers a perfect blend of natural beauty and cultural richness.
